Bits and Bobs: Apartments 1 and 2 are on the lower ground floor of our building but this lower floor is not connected internally to the upper floors. Instead they share a hallway and entrance door leading out on to a courtyard (with a small laundry with washing machine & timber dryer shared between both studios which is located in the old Victorian WC block). Old stone outside steps run above the laundry and take you up to a platform at ground floor level (with a guest bike rack should you want need it) and a secure gate leads out on to Ship Street Gardens which is arguably one of Brighton’s most beautiful ancient twittens - an Olde Sussex word meaning ‘lane’. This brick paved pedestrian lane is less than 100 meters long running between Ship Street to the east (where the front of our building is located) and Middle Street to the west with some beautiful cottages and shops along it’s whole length.
